These days, finding an affordable place to live in the Bogota area can be challenging. Home prices in Bogota are now at a median cost of $352,941, lower than the New Jersey average of $388,929.
The average cost of rent is $1,529/mo in Bogota, primarily driven by the current value of real estate in the Bogota area. While nearly 34.58% of residents own their homes outright in Bogota, 31.77% rent.
Housing affordability isn’t just about home prices, though. The average household income in Bogota is $8,682 per month. Households that rent pay about 17.61% of their income on rent here. Bogota's most expensive areas are in the northern regions, while the cheapest areas are in the southwestern parts of the city.
